NITI Aayog Releases DPI 2047 Roadmap for Inclusive Growth in Viksit Bharat

NITI Aayog has unveiled 'DPI@2047 for Viksit Bharat', a strategic roadmap designed to leverage Digital Public Infrastructure for inclusive socio-economic growth. The document outlines a 25-year plan to scale digital systems like Aadhaar, UPI, and ONDC to achieve a 'Viksit Bharat' (Developed India) status by 2047, focusing on non-linear growth and universal service access.

Why it matters

The roadmap defines Digital Public Infrastructure (DPI) as the core underlying layer of a digital economy, comparable to physical infrastructure like roads and ports. The document builds on the success of the 'India Stack' and proposes the creation of new DPIs in sectors such as health, education, and agriculture. The strategy emphasizes 'open standards' and 'interoperability' to ensure that private innovations can build upon government-led foundational platforms. By 2047, the goal is to eliminate digital divides and ensure that governance is delivered in a 'paperless and presence-less' manner to every citizen.

The administrative importance of this roadmap lies in its role as a template for various Union Ministries and State governments to align their digital transformation projects. It advocates for the 'Data Empowerment and Protection Architecture' (DEPA) to give citizens control over their personal data. For the economy, NITI Aayog predicts that widespread DPI adoption will add significant basis points to the annual GDP growth by reducing transaction costs and increasing formalization.

Glossary

Viksit Bharat: The vision of the Government of India to make the nation a developed country by 100 years of independence (2047).

ONDC: Open Network for Digital Commerce, a DPI intended to democratize e-commerce by providing an open alternative to proprietary platforms.
